Output 962599676d8f503704121dd38b6e3de90033f2d994e27feeccb17abc71467e5b:5

value
148904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35bb75c52438c4a5edbd10cc0fc8e8fb44e81172 OP_EQUAL
address
36b8JfPPmrUxiJBNte1S9NmjMFwMjX8sVr
transaction
962599676d8f503704121dd38b6e3de90033f2d994e27feeccb17abc71467e5b
spent
true